Job Title: Heavy Equipment Operator
Job Description
The Heavy Equipment Operator will safely and efficiently operate dozers, excavators, and other heavy machinery to support civil construction, earth moving, and dirt work on large commercial projects. The role focuses on site preparation, grading, and foundational work while maintaining high standards of safety, quality, and productivity. This position is well suited for an experienced operator who takes pride in precision work and can travel to various project sites.
